Default Hi everyone

My name is Deborah and I am 37 years old and was DX with my MS on 1997 at the age of 25. My current DX is Secondary progressive Multiple Sclerosis. My MS Dr. Told me not to get scared of the medical terms. I smiled at him and told him that I may MS but MS does not have me and that I keep my self positive and active and more importantly I leave everything in Gods hands.
